WebJul 7, 2016 · Your Form W-2 tells you how much you earned from your employer in the past year and how much withholding tax you've already paid on those earnings. Generally, you … WebFeb 13, 2024 · Box 2 shows the total amount of federal income tax withheld by your employer on your behalf. Boxes 3-6 Boxes 3 and 5 show the amount of your earnings subject to Social Security and Medicare taxes, respectively. Boxes 4 and 6 show the amount of Social Security and Medicare taxes withheld.

WebJan 13, 2024 · Box 12 amounts with the code DD signify the total cost of what you and your employer paid for your employer-sponsored health coverage plan.. Code DD amounts are for informational purposes only—they don't affect the numbers in your tax return. WebApr 11, 2024 · Combined income is defined as your adjusted gross income plus nontaxable interest plus half of your Social Security benefits. If you file taxes singly and your combined income is $25,000-$34,000, you may owe income taxes on 50% of your Social Security benefits.
